Notice of Participation in the 2025 International Robot Exhibition from December 3 (Wednesday) to December 6 (Saturday), 2025

ビジュアル・コンポネンツ・ジャパン (Visual Components) ビジュアル・コンポネンツ・ジャパン (Visual Components) 東京支店
Visual Components Japan will be exhibiting at the "2025 International Robot Exhibition" held at Tokyo Big Sight. This exhibition aims to create industries and solve social issues through the coexistence and collaboration of humans and robots, with the theme of "A Sustainable Society Brought by Robotics." During the event, advanced robots and cutting-edge technologies related to robotics, such as AI, ICT, and component technologies, will be showcased from both domestic and international sources. We sincerely look forward to your visit.
Date and time Wednesday, Dec 03, 2025 ~ Saturday, Dec 06, 2025
10:00 AM ~ 05:00 PM
Capital ■Venue: Tokyo Big Sight, East Halls 4-8, West Halls 1-4, Atrium ■Address: 3-11-1 Ariake, Koto-ku, Tokyo 135-0063 ■Nearest Stations - Rinkai Line "Kokusai Tenjijo Station" - About a 7-minute walk - Yurikamome "Tokyo Big Sight Station" - About a 3-minute walk
Entry fee Free

Accelerating welding automation in furniture manufacturing! Improving productivity with OLP × robot introduction.

Case Study Utilizing Robot Simulation and OLP: What Welding Automation Challenges Did a Company Famous for High-Quality Outdoor Furniture Face?

We would like to introduce a case study of the implementation of "Visual Components Robotics OLP" at Berlin Gardens, a company famous for its high-quality outdoor furniture. The company faced challenges in automating its manufacturing processes, particularly in welding, as the demand for furniture continued to grow. With the introduction of this product, they were able to efficiently teach robots to perform complex tasks, such as welding aluminum fixtures to the bottoms of furniture, achieving stable production speed and quality. [Effects] - The programming of complex fixtures, which previously took 13 hours before production could start, is now completed in just under 3 hours. - This has led to a reduction in labor costs. - Overall agility in the company's operations has also improved. *For more details, please download the PDF or feel free to contact us.

[Visual Components Case Study] Transforming the Production Process

Examples of promoting innovation in forestry machinery and improving productivity!

We would like to introduce a case study of the implementation of "Visual Components Robotics OLP" at Ponsse, a company engaged in forestry machinery manufacturing. When the company introduced robotic welding into its operations, the complexity and time-consuming nature of robot teaching became a challenge. Teaching was conducted online using a teach pendant, and the robot had to be stopped for two weeks until the teaching was completed. After the implementation, the advantage is that robot teaching can be done outside of the production system, allowing for faster and easier progress without stopping production. [Case Overview] ■Challenges - The downtime of the robot until teaching was completed posed a risk of delays in the manufacturing process, significantly impacting costs. ■Results - Significant time savings, improved productivity and utilization of automation, streamlined robot station planning, and achieved faster and smoother robot teaching. *For more details, please download the PDF or feel free to contact us.

[Visual Components Case Study] Addressing the Shortage of Welders

Optimization of robot offline teaching workflows to enhance production efficiency!

We would like to introduce a case study of the implementation of "Visual Components OLP" at AMI Attachments, a manufacturer of heavy machinery attachments. The company faced the challenge of improving production efficiency while responding to changing market demands, as well as a shortage of welding technicians. By implementing this product, they were able to reduce teaching time by 70%, achieving improvements in both production efficiency and quality. [Case Overview] ■ Challenge: In low-volume, high-variety production, manual robot teaching is time-consuming and prone to errors. ■ Results - A customized training program enabled them to maximize the use of the product. - Remote and on-site calibration minimized downtime, allowing for smooth operations and accurate robot setup. *For more details, please download the PDF or feel free to contact us.

[Visual Components Case Study] Visualization of CNC Machining

Introducing a case where the speed and efficiency of proposal creation have dramatically improved!

We would like to introduce a case study on the implementation of "Visual Components" at Mazak UK, a company specializing in CNC machine tools. The company faced challenges in conveying the complexity of the PALLETECH system using traditional 2D drawings, which hindered smooth communication with customers and prolonged the time taken to make proposals. However, the introduction of our product dramatically changed the situation. It not only significantly reduced project planning and execution time, improving efficiency, but also strengthened engagement with customers, leading to new achievements. 【Case Overview】 ■Challenges - It was difficult to explain and incorporate the advanced and flexible modular production system "PALLETECH system" into planning. ■Results - Previously, it took about 4 days to create a proposal, but now it can be done in about 30 minutes. *For more details, please download the PDF or feel free to contact us.

[Seminar] INPEX's Challenge: Technology Development and Business Outlook for CO2 Methanation

  • NEW
  • SEMINAR_EVENT

[Speaker] Mr. Itsuki Wakayama, Project General Manager, Technology Promotion Unit, Low Carbon Solutions Division, INPEX Corporation [Key Lecture Content] The greatest advantage of synthetic methane production through CO2 methanation technology is that it enables decarbonization without significant additions or modifications to all existing natural gas and city gas infrastructure. At INPEX, after two NEDO commissioned projects, we have been conducting the development of practical application technology with a capacity of 400 Nm3-CO2/h, one of the largest in the world, as a subsidized project by NEDO since the fiscal year 2021. By the fiscal year 2025, we aim to achieve the injection of synthetic methane produced during the demonstration operation of the test facility. This presentation will provide detailed information on the results of the NEDO project for the fiscal year 2025, including the current status of the latest test facilities. [Presentation Items] 1. INPEX's efforts towards net zero by 2050 2. Policy trends related to CO2 methanation 3. Challenges of CO2 methanation 4. Results of the NEDO practical application technology development project with a capacity of 400 Nm3-CO2/h for the fiscal year 2025 5. Future commercialization prospects and challenges 6.
